Pros: Produces lots of juice, motor quiet, requires little effort in applying pressure.
Cons: Clogs easily, have to move fast to stop the rumble, must handle blade very carefully!
The Bottom Line: I would recommend this to a friend. The amount and quality of the juice produced is quality and it works well with most fruits and vegetables

| dbell00's Full Review: Jack Lalanne 10091 Power Juicer |
I was given a power juicer 2 days ago and I am amazed. In the beginning, I was shocked with the rumble when a piece of fruit hits the bottom. Its like you have to move at turbo speed to make sure you apply enough pressure! I was pleased with the texture and quantity of juice the Juicer produced. It juices very fast and it works well for long time use, as long as its cleaned. I like the safety features, the weight is easy to manage, the juicer attracts people because many saw the commercial, but never tried it for themselves. I like how the opening is large enough to fit whole fruits, instead of cutting everything. Just make sure the fruit does not have a huge seed, such a s peaches, or else the motor may stop. Also, I enjoy how it juices the most toughest of vegetables without causing any problems. Just make sure the motor comes to a complete stop before you remove the pressure handle, or else the remaining particles may flight out, causing a mess, or particles to fly in your eyes. Overall, the Power Juicer delivers what it promises regarding the amount of juice production and quality. As always read everything before officially using this new toy!
